While White Hart Lane station lacks a traditional ticket office, there are numerous 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ets. These machines are conveniently accessible for travelers with disabilities, ensuring a hassle-free experience. The station also supports step-free access across its premises, further enhancing ease for passengers. While there is no luggage storage or waiting room, travelers can still find seating areas to rest their feet.
In terms of technology, public Wi-Fi is accessible, enabling you to stay connected while on the go. There are no ATMs or refreshment facilities on-site, so it’s advisable to make any necessary arrangements beforehand. CCTV cameras are installed to provide an added layer of security for travelers.
Getting to and from White Hart Lane station is simple thanks to its robust connection with local transport services. Transport for London buses operate from just outside the station, making it easy to navigate through the city. If rail service disruptions occur, bus stops on High Road can assist with onward travel north to Enfield Town and Cheshunt or south to Liverpool Street.
Though taxis and car hire options are not directly available at the station, alternatives can be easily accessed nearby. The station area does not offer dedicated spaces for accessible taxis or set-down points, so plan your journey with this in mind.

When visiting Knutsford Train Station, you'll find several essential amenities to assist with your journey. The station operates a well-timed ticket office that opens early and closes late: Monday to Friday from 06:30 to 20:30, Saturday from 07:00 to 19:30, and Sunday from 12:10 to 19:40. For convenience, there are ticket machines available, including accessible ones, as well as facilities to collect tickets purchased online. Accessibility features are integrated into the station’s layout. Designated as a Category B Station, there is step-free access to some areas, with separate level entrances for platforms heading towards Chester and Manchester.
If you require additional support, staff assistance is available from Monday, 06:30 to 20:00. Additionally, there is an induction loop for the hearing impaired, and a ramp is available for train access. While there are no waiting rooms, passengers can find ample seating areas on the platforms.
Moving beyond the station, Knutsford provides multiple onward travel options. If your journey requires rail replacement services, pick-up and drop-off points are conveniently located at bus stops on Adams Hill. For those seeking local taxi services, details are accessible via Northern Railway's taxi information page. Buses are also a viable option, with connections available through Traveline at 0871 200 2233. Cyclists would need to look elsewhere for bicycle hire as this facility is not available at the station.
